Program Overview

Our teen encounters are 3-day, 2-night roaming adventures that are truly wild. We spend the entirety of our time outdoors, away from fixtures, features, tech, or amenities. Our adventures are self-sustaining, and allow you to truly get away from it all.

The trajectory of the adventure is up to you, as we explore woods, wilderness and coastline. We experience hiking, fishing, cooking, swimming, fire making, navigating, all while discovering the beauty of Prince Edward Island. Campfires, story-telling, and ghostly thrills await us when the sun goes down, while afterward we'll tent under the stars.
